Does Chick-fil-A Still Serve Coffee?

Yes, Chick-fil-A serves coffee at most of its locations all day. You have three main choices: hot coffee, iced coffee, and frosted coffee.

  • Hot coffee is freshly brewed and can be served black or with cream and sugar.
  • Iced coffee is cold brew mixed with 2% milk and cane sugar, served over ice.
  • Frosted coffee blends cold brew with Icedream®, creating a dessert-style drink.

You can order any of these in-store, at the drive-thru, or through the Chick-fil-A app. Some locations even offer delivery.

Chick Fil A Hot Coffee

A steaming cup of Chick-fil-A hot coffee on a wooden table, with a blurred background of a cozy café setting.

Chick-fil-A hot coffee is made with 100% Arabica beans and has a smooth medium-roast flavor with light caramel and nutty notes. A regular black coffee contains 0 calories and about 142 mg of caffeine per 12 oz cup.

You can customize it with cream, milk, sugar, or sugar-free sweeteners to match your taste.

Chick-fil-A Iced Coffee

Chick-fil-A's new iced coffee, featuring a refreshing blend, is displayed in a clear cup with ice and a straw.

Chick-fil-A iced coffee is made with cold-brewed coffee, 2% milk, and cane sugar served over ice. It has a smooth and slightly sweet flavor and is available in Original and Vanilla options.

A regular iced coffee contains about 200 calories and includes milk. You can also customize it with less sugar, extra flavor, or different sweeteners.

Chick-fil-A Frosted Coffee

A refreshing Chick-fil-A frosted coffee drink topped with whipped cream and a straw, served in a clear cup.

Chick-fil-A Frosted Coffee is a creamy frozen drink made with cold-brewed coffee and Chick-fil-A Icedream®. It has a sweet, smooth flavor and tastes more like a dessert than regular coffee.

A regular Frosted Coffee contains about 260 calories, 7g fat, 45g carbs, 44g sugar, and 7g protein. It also contains milk as a main allergen.

What Makes Chick-fil-A Coffee Different?

Chick-fil-A coffee is made with 100% Arabica beans, giving it a smooth and less bitter taste with light caramel and nutty flavors.

The brand also uses ethically sourced coffee through the THRIVE Farmers program and offers different styles like hot, iced, and frosted coffee for every taste.
